Maintaining a lush, green lawn in Pittsfield, VT can be a rewarding experience if the right lawn care practices are observed. With the region's climate, it's crucial to know what works best to ensure your lawn stays healthy and attractive throughout the year.

First, mowing is critical to any lawn care routine. For Pittsfield residents, it's best to start mowing in late spring when the grass is growing fastest due to the rain and warm temperatures. Remember to set your mower's blade to about 3 inches high to avoid cutting the grass too short, which can stress it and make it more susceptible to pests and diseases.

Fertilizing is another essential practice. A slow-release granular fertilizer works best for the soil type in neighborhoods like Upper Michigan Road and Tweed River Drive. The best time to fertilize in Pittsfield is in early spring and late fall. This will provide your lawn with the nutrients it needs to grow strong and healthy.

Seeding comes next, particularly if you have bare spots in your lawn. The ideal time to overseed is in late summer or early fall when the temperatures are cooler. Water the newly seeded areas daily until the grass germinates and reaches mowing height.

Watering, aerating, and dethatching are also essential for a healthy lawn. The best time to water your lawn is early morning to reduce evaporation. Aerating should be done in the fall, and it helps to improve soil drainage and stimulate root growth. Dethatching, on the other hand, should be done in early spring or late fall. It involves removing the layer of dead grass and moss that can hinder the growth of new grass.
